The Fashion Sleuth How to Research the Internet for Fashion Author:M. Kathleen Colussy For introduction to fashion, design, or marketing courses that involve research. This book is geared specifically to information fluency for the fashion industry -- covering traditional and non-traditional research -- and is meant to help the reader overcome any Internet research phobia. Written to make students more proficient and confident in ... more »using the Internet and the computer as a tool for conducting research, this book provides insider industry secrets to researching the Internet for fashion design and/or fashion marketing related information through easy to understand and follow step-by-step exercises. The companion CD contains over 1,600 URLs including links for business, marketing, forecasting, global trade shows, global sourcing markets by country, and a global list of online museums and other historical and art resources. This book will teach students to research beyond Google , how to use Boolean Logic and Search Engine Math, to conduct an Advanced Search online, and give them a better understanding of how to mine the Deep Web.
